Amos 8:4 in context

The verses around it, from Amos 8.

1 This is what the Lord GOD showed me: I saw a basket of summer fruit.

2 “Amos, what do you see?” He asked. “A basket of summer fruit,” I replied. So the LORD said to me, “The end has come for My people Israel; I will no longer spare them.”

3 “In that day,” declares the Lord GOD, “the songs of the temple will turn to wailing. Many will be the corpses, strewn in silence everywhere!”

4 Hear this, you who trample the needy, who do away with the poor of the land,

5 asking, “When will the New Moon be over, that we may sell grain? When will the Sabbath end, that we may market wheat? Let us reduce the ephah and increase the shekel; let us cheat with dishonest scales.

6 Let us buy the poor with silver and the needy for a pair of sandals, selling even the chaff with the wheat!”

7 The LORD has sworn by the Pride of Jacob: “I will never forget any of their deeds.

8 Will not the land quake for this, and all its dwellers mourn? All of it will swell like the Nile; it will surge and then subside like the Nile in Egypt.
